Abstract
The dual probe-fed patch technique, which is used to suppress unwanted prob e radiation in wideband probe-fed microstrip patches, is extended for the c ase of a balanced two-patch subarray. To demonstrate this technique two S-b and microstrip arrays were fabricated: with and without the balanced two-pa tch sub-arrays. The balanced array showed a reduction in the cross-polarisa tion peak level by nearly 10dB. The unwanted radiation is effectively suppr essed (20dB cross-polarisation isolation) over a bandwidth of greater than 6.3%.
